The transition from syrup to crystal is both an art and a science. The text covers vacuum pan design, seeding techniques, and the "three-boiling" scheme used to exhaust molasses.
One of the most expensive parts of sugar production is energy consumption. Rein introduces complex multiple-effect evaporator configurations, teaching readers how to maximize steam economy—a critical factor in making a sugar mill self-sufficient or even an exporter of electricity (co-generation). Peter Rein is a name synonymous with innovation in sugar processing. With a career spanning decades—including a significant tenure at the University of Natal and as a leading consultant for global sugar giants—Rein bridged the gap between theoretical chemical engineering and practical, "boots-on-the-ground" factory management.
